    wood working? great topic on halloween

    You do not need any specialty tools. Just the basics- table saw, miter saw, drill press, band saw, sanders, routers, drills, air compressor, paint guns and clamps, clamps, clamps, (never enough clamps). More will be needed but this gives you the idea. Time is money when you are building items...

    Very Small Concrete Slab Patch - Hand Mix?

    It can be done......but it depends on how in shape you and your arms are. To hand mix concrete right will take a good amount of energy. I have mixed a few bags by hand to pour a slab and I vowed to buy a mixer next time. I now have a electric mixer that makes things much easier. I have used...
